The Global Cooking Oil Market is projected to expand from USD 214.29 Billion in 2025 to USD 289.64 Billion by 2031, achieving a CAGR of 5.15%. Defined as lipid-based liquids derived principally from plant, animal, or synthetic origins, cooking oils function as essential mediums for culinary tasks such as frying, baking, and flavoring. This market growth is fundamentally underpinned by strong demographic drivers, specifically global population increases and rapid urbanization, which necessitate higher total food production. Additionally, rising disposable incomes in emerging economies are driving a dietary transition toward greater consumption of processed foods and edible fats. Highlighting this trajectory, the 'Union for the Promotion of Oil and Protein Plants' noted in '2025' that global vegetable oil production is expected to reach 234.5 million tonnes for the 2025/26 crop year.

Despite this positive momentum, the sector encounters significant hurdles regarding raw material price volatility. The industry's deep dependence on agricultural commodities makes it highly susceptible to climatic irregularities and geopolitical tensions, both of which can severely interrupt supply chains. This instability results in erratic input costs, thereby compressing profit margins for manufacturers and creating pricing uncertainties that may impede long-term market expansion.

Market Driver

The increasing application of vegetable oils as feedstock for biofuel production acts as a primary catalyst altering global demand dynamics. Governments around the world are aggressively raising blending mandates for biodiesel and renewable diesel, shifting substantial volumes of feedstock away from food supply chains and into energy sectors. This structural transition is most apparent in major producing nations, where energy security strategies prioritize domestic lipid consumption over exports. Consequently, industrial demand competes directly with culinary applications, leading to tighter inventories and higher price floors for raw materials. Evidence of this trend is found in the Indonesian Palm Oil Association's (GAPKI) March 2025 44th-anniversary report, which projects that domestic palm oil consumption allocated for the B40 biodiesel program will reach 13.6 million tons in 2025.

Simultaneously, rising disposable incomes and urbanization in emerging economies are fueling unprecedented consumption volumes, particularly in import-dependent regions. As populations migrate toward urban centers, there is a distinct shift from traditional, unrefined fats to packaged, processed edible oils available through organized retail channels. This surge in demand is further intensified by the inability of domestic crop production in developing nations to match these dietary shifts, necessitating a heavy reliance on cross-border trade. According to the Solvent Extractors' Association of India's November 2025 annual import data, India imported 16 million tonnes of edible oils during the 2024-25 marketing year to meet this growing domestic requirement, supporting a global vegetable oil trade that the USDA projected in January 2025 would reach 86.4 million tons.

Market Challenge

Raw material price volatility represents a significant barrier to the sustainable growth of the global cooking oil market. The industry's intrinsic reliance on agricultural crops exposes supply chains to unpredictable weather patterns and geopolitical instability, resulting in sudden and often severe fluctuations in input costs. This unpredictability creates a challenging environment for manufacturers, who face compressed profit margins and heightened financial risk. Consequently, businesses are frequently forced to postpone capital investments or raise consumer prices, actions which can dampen demand and constrain the overall volume of market growth.

The direct impact of these supply and pricing irregularities is evident in the contraction of trade volumes for key commodities. When prices spike or supplies become erratic, major import markets are compelled to reduce their procurement, stalling the sector's upward trajectory. For instance, the 'Solvent Extractors' Association of India' reported in '2025' that palm oil imports declined sharply to 7.58 million tonnes from 9.02 million tonnes in the previous year due to unfavorable price disparities. Such volatility limits the market's capacity to maintain consistent momentum, directly hampering volume growth despite the presence of underlying demand.

Market Trends

The transition toward sustainable and RSPO-certified palm oil sourcing is fundamentally reshaping procurement strategies as the industry aligns with stringent environmental governance and deforestation-free supply chain mandates. This movement is characterized by a comprehensive departure from conventional, opaque trading models toward certified frameworks that prioritize ecological preservation and ethical social responsibility. Producers are increasingly adopting rigorous standards to separate lipid production from habitat degradation, creating a premium market tier for verifiable, eco-friendly ingredients. Confirming this industry-wide shift, the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il's 'Impact Update 2025', released in July 2025, reported that the total global certified oil palm area reached 5.1 million hectares, effectively securing the conservation of over 425,000 hectares of high conservation value forests.

At the same time, the expansion of the used cooking oil (UCO)-to-biofuel circular economy is emerging as a critical value driver, distinguishing itself from primary crop-based energy models by valorizing waste streams. Unlike the resource competition associated with virgin vegetable oils, this trend focuses on establishing sophisticated reverse logistics networks to recover waste lipids for conversion into renewable diesel and sustainable aviation fuel (SAF). This development effectively turns a disposal challenge into a revenue-generating commodity trade, reducing reliance on agricultural inputs. Underscoring the global scale of this waste-to-energy trade, the United States Department of Agriculture Foreign Agricultural Service noted in its March 2025 'China: UCO Trade Update' report that China's exports of used cooking oil to the United States reached a record 1.27 million metric tons in 2024.
